Dual CMOS op amp for single-supply signal chains

The ROHM BD7562SFVM-TR is a dual CMOS operational amplifier with rail-to-rail output, packaged in an 8-MSOP. Operating from a single supply spanning 5 V to 14.5 V, it covers common industrial and automotive rails.

Supply voltage range is 5 V to 14.5 V.

The BD7562SFVM-TR is supplied in an 8-MSOP package with a 0.110" body width and 2.80 mm footprint. Surface-mount assembly; the tape-and-reel or cut-tape option suits both prototype and production volumes.

Is BD7562SFVM-TR rail-to-rail output?

Yes, the output type is rail-to-rail, which maximizes dynamic range in single-supply designs. The input common-mode range is not specified as rail-to-rail, so verify the input swing against your signal range.

What is the equivalent or alternative to BD7562SFVM-TR?

The single-channel sibling BD7561SG-TR shares the same 1 MHz GBW, 1 V/µs slew rate, and 1 pA input bias, but in a single op-amp package.
